Buyer’s Guide: How to Choose the Best Convection Toaster Ovens in 2025

Choosing the best convection toaster ovens in 2025 means balancing durability, cooking performance, countertop space and the smart features you really need. Below are the key factors to evaluate so you end up with a convection oven toaster that fits your kitchen and lifestyle.

Materials and durability

– Exterior finish: Look for stainless steel or coated metal exteriors for scratch resistance and easier cleaning. Fingerprint-resistant finishes are a useful plus.
– Interior construction: A ceramic or enamel-coated interior resists staining and is easier to wipe clean than bare metal. Heavier-gauge steel and welded seams indicate sturdier builds.
– Racks and trays: Removable, durable racks (chrome-plated or stainless) and non-stick baking trays help longevity. Check how securely accessories fit—loose or flimsy trays are common failure points.
– Hinges and handles: Robust door hinges and a solid handle reduce the risk of sagging or breakage over time.

Performance and efficiency

– Convection vs. conventional: True convection models use a dedicated fan and often a rear heating element to circulate air, delivering more even, faster browning than conventional toaster ovens.
– Wattage and heating: Higher wattage typically gives faster preheat and better high-heat performance (useful for broiling and air-frying), but consider energy-efficient designs if you’re concerned about power use.
– Temperature control and accuracy: Precise digital thermostats and consistent temperature hold are important if you bake or roast regularly. Look for ovens with accurate temperature calibration or user-adjustable offsets.
– Cooking modes: Multi-function ovens (toast, bake, broil, roast, reheat, air fry) provide versatility. If you plan to use it as your main countertop oven, prioritize models with dependable bake and roast settings.
– Recovery time: How quickly the oven returns to set temperature after opening the door matters for consistent results, especially for baking.

Size, weight, and portability

– Capacity: Check internal dimensions and listed capacities (often in liters or “slice” equivalents). A 4–6-slice toaster oven fits small households; a 12–18” wide convection oven handles sheet pans and larger roasts.
– Countertop footprint: Measure the space where the oven will sit, and remember to allow clearance for ventilation and door swing.
– Weight and placement: Heavier models with sturdy construction are more durable but less portable. If you’re moving the oven often (RV, dorms, seasonal use), prioritize lighter, compact models.
– Rack positions and interior layout: Multiple rack levels increase versatility—useful for baking different items simultaneously.

Extra features and accessories

– Digital controls and presets: Easy-to-use touchscreens, programmable presets, and a clear display make everyday use smoother. Smart features (Wi‑Fi, app control) are now available in some 2025 models.
– Included accessories: Look for crumb trays, baking pans, air-fry baskets, pizza stones, and rotisserie kits if those functions matter to you.
– Safety features: Auto shutoff, cool-touch handles, and non-slip feet are important for family kitchens.
– Ease of cleaning: Removable crumb trays, dishwasher-safe racks, and accessible interiors reduce maintenance time.

Price and warranty

– Price tiers: Entry-level convection toaster ovens are budget-friendly but may compromise on build and accuracy. Mid-range models balance features and durability; premium models offer larger capacity, faster heat, and advanced controls.
– Warranty and support: A 1–2 year warranty is typical; extended warranties or responsive customer service can add value if you expect frequent use. Check what’s covered (electronics, heating elements, wear parts).
– Long-term cost: Consider replacement parts, energy efficiency, and reliability—sometimes a slightly higher upfront price saves money over years of use.

3. Q: Are the best convection toaster ovens more energy efficient than full-size ovens?
A: Yes — generally the best convection toaster ovens use less energy than full-size ovens because they heat a smaller cavity and often cook faster thanks to circulating air. For energy-conscious buyers, pick models with efficient insulation, a variable thermostat, and a powerful but quiet fan to maximize cooking speed and minimize wasted heat.

4. Q: What maintenance tips keep the best convection toaster ovens performing well?
A: Regular cleaning prolongs performance: wipe interior after cooling, remove crumbs from trays, and clean the heating elements gently per the manual. Avoid abrasive cleaners and keep the door seal intact. Calibrate temperature periodically and check for loose racks or damaged cords to ensure your best convection toaster ovens maintain consistent cooking and safety.
